Bata Pakistan has approved a major restructuring plan to consolidate its manufacturing operations in Lahore. The decision aims to improve efficiency and reduce operational costs.
According to a disclosure submitted to the Pakistan Stock Exchange, Bata will combine production activities from two separate factories into one integrated manufacturing facility.
The company said production currently taking place at the Batapur Factory on GT Road and the Maraka Factory on Multan Road will be shifted to the Batapur site. The consolidation is part of Bataโs broader strategy to streamline operations.
Officials stated that the move follows Bata Globalโs international manufacturing optimization plan. The strategy focuses on lean manufacturing practices and improving productivity across production facilities worldwide.
Bata explained that the consolidation is expected to increase operational efficiency and improve resource utilization. The company also aims to achieve economies of scale through centralized production.
Management believes the restructuring will support long-term business growth. It is also expected to strengthen Bataโs position in export markets in the future.
According to the company, the transition process will begin on June 1, 2026. The consolidation is expected to be completed by July 15, 2026, subject to regulatory and operational approvals.
Bata said the transfer of production activities from the Maraka facility will take place gradually in different phases. The company expects the process to continue without major disruption.
Officials assured shareholders that customer deliveries and supply commitments would remain unaffected during the transition period. Bata stated that production activities would continue smoothly throughout the restructuring process.
The company also highlighted the expected financial benefits of the move. Management said the consolidation would create operational synergies and support long-term cost efficiency.
Bata further stated that employees affected by the restructuring would be managed according to company policies and labor laws. The company emphasized that worker-related matters would be handled responsibly.

The board described the decision as part of a broader effort to strengthen sustainability, profitability, and competitiveness. Bata believes the manufacturing consolidation will help improve future business performance in Pakistan and international markets.
